"ISl Study 2" is a captivating 5x7 relief print that captures the raw beauty of a seascape. The piece is created with ink on handmade, textured off-white paper and features a minimalistic and abstract representation of a coastal scene. The composition uses black ink lines to outline a coastal cliff or a rock formation, accompanied by a serene blue wash at the base, symbolizing the sea. Above the cliff, a gray wash suggests the presence of clouds or mist, adding an atmospheric depth to the scene.
The horizontal linear composition is enriched with intricate lines that denote movement and texture in both the sky and water, enhancing the overall dynamism of the artwork. This seascape is evocative of the small islands and rock formations off the coast of Iceland, drawn from sketches made during travels.
What's truly unique about this monoprint is the use of Chine-collé technique combined with handmade recycled paper, making it a one-of-a-kind piece within a series. The texture and organic simplicity of the paper add an additional layer of authenticity and tactile richness to the artwork, inviting viewers to explore its serene yet dynamic beauty.
